View Notes--------------------------------------------------------- - Mixed by [email protected] - FLAC conversion 30-APR-2017 - Trader Little Helper - Tagged 30-APR-2017 - Tag&Rename --------------------------------------------------------- More On DTS Today's audio standards are moving towards multi-channel sound, like DTS and Dolby Digital. While the Audio-CD standard (Red Book) hasn't changed to accommodate these new sound formats, it is still possible to go around the specification and to put a 5.1 surround recording on a regular Audio-CD. To play a DTS-Audio-CD you must connect your DVD/CD player via a digital cable (optical or coaxial) to your DTS Dolby-Digital receiver. It is not 100% sure that your receiver will recognize a DTS-Audio CD, so the first time you're trying to playback a DTS-Audio-CD you must do a test to determine if it can. Begin with the volume very low, start the disc and raise the volume gradually. NEVER listen to a DTS-Audio-CD through the analog audio outputs of your CD/DVD player. Burning Instructions Burn them the absolute same way as you would burn any normal Audio-CD from FLAC files. Brokedown House Production

View NotesSource: Healy SBD Ultramix Patch > Sony D5 > MSC(Maxell MX90 Type IV Cassettes). Transfer: MSC playback on Nakamichi DR2 > gold connector shielded 3ft RCA monster cable > Audiophile 2496 soundcard /P4 2 GHz > recorded as 24 bit/48 KHz WAV using Wavelab 5. Mastering: Wavelab 5.0 (24/48 files rendered to 16 bit/44.1 KHz using Waves L3 Multimaximizer with hi resolution CD rendering settings (threshold -2 dB / ceiling -0.1 dB / type I dither / ultra shaping) > tracking with CDWAV 1.9 > 16 bit FLAC. Transfer and encoding by Chris Ladner. Big thanks to the provider of the MSC's who for various reasons wishes to remain anonymous. Levels at the beginning of the first set were generally low for the first minute. I adjusted this post transfer using Wavelab. The beginning of "Cumberland Blues" is clipped - I patched the missing 10 seconds from the FOB Schoeps source. Brief tape flips occured during non-musical segment between "Just Like Tom Thumb's Blues" and "Hey Pocky Way" and during "Space" and were crossfaded into audio imperceptibility using Wavelab 5. This source does not have any skipping during "Black Muddy River". As far as Healy Ultramixes go this one is SWEET - just the right mix of crowd and music. Crowd is chanting for Phil before JLTTB - listen for Phil saying "and my best friend my drummer won't tell me what it is that I dropped." KILLER performances of "Loser" & "Ramble On Rose".
